US Secretary of State Antony Blinken arrives in Egypt to push Gaza ceasefire

Economictimes.indiatimes.com 

US Secretary of State Antony Blinken arrived in Cairo to discuss a ceasefire in Gaza with Egyptian officials. His visit comes amid recent blasts in Lebanon, blamed on Israel by Hezbollah. Blinken will meet with Egyptian leader Abdel Fattah al-Sisi and Foreign Minister Badr Abdelatty but will not visit Israel this time.

Tupperware files for bankruptcy: Why the tiffin box and bottle maker lost its colour after Covid

Economictimes.indiatimes.com 

Tupperware Brands and its subsidiaries have fil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ection due to declining demand for their food storage containers and increasing losses. The company faced challenges with rising raw material, labor, and freight costs post-pandemic. Tupperware listed assets between $500 million to $1 billion and liabilities between $1 billion to $10 billion.
